Carbon Tokenization: How Blockchain Technology Can Help Tackle Climate Change
Climate change is one of the most pressing issues facing our planet today. The increase in greenhouse gas emissions and resulting global warming is causing devastating effects, such as more frequent and intense natural disasters, rising sea levels, and the loss of biodiversity. Governments, corporations, and individuals must work together to reduce carbon emissions and combat climate change. One innovative solution is the concept of carbon tokenization, which uses blockchain technology to incentivize and track carbon reduction efforts.
Carbon
tokenization is the process of converting carbon credits into digital tokens
that can be traded on blockchain platforms. Carbon credits are a form of
currency that represents one ton of carbon dioxide equivalent (CO2e) that has
been prevented from being released into the atmosphere. These credits are
earned through carbon reduction projects, such as reforestation, renewable
energy projects, and energy efficiency improvements.
By
tokenizing carbon credits, companies and individuals can create a market for
carbon trading, where the value of carbon credits can be determined by supply
and demand. This can incentivize the adoption of carbon reduction efforts by
creating a financial incentive for companies to reduce their emissions.
Additionally, tokenization can make the process of trading carbon credits more
efficient, transparent, and secure.
Blockchain
technology is the perfect platform for carbon tokenization. The decentralized
nature of blockchain allows for a transparent and secure record of carbon
credits and transactions. Smart contracts can automate the process of carbon
credit verification, issuance, and trading, reducing the need for
intermediaries and increasing efficiency. Furthermore, blockchain can enable
the tracking of carbon emissions throughout the supply chain, providing
valuable insights into carbon reduction opportunities.

In
addition to creating a market for carbon credits, carbon tokenization can also
facilitate the funding of carbon reduction projects. Tokenized carbon credits
can be used to finance carbon reduction initiatives, such as renewable energy
projects, that may not have been feasible without the financial support
provided by carbon credits.
Moreover,
carbon tokenization can also help address the issue of carbon credit fraud.
Carbon credit fraud is a major problem in the carbon market, with some
estimates suggesting that up to 85% of carbon credits may be fraudulent.
Tokenization can help prevent fraud by creating a transparent and secure record
of carbon credits and transactions. Smart contracts can automate the process of
verification, reducing the risk of human error and fraud.
